Abstract

This chapter provides an account of the many changes in police investigative approaches to rape since the early 1980s. The Handbook editors' desire to bring together academics and practitioners provided us with the unique opportunity to integrate a police officer's 'on the job' experience investigating rape over the past 30 years alongside the academic literature.
